When it comes to track days or competitive racing, every component of your car matters—but few are as critical as the fuel pump. A high-performance fuel pump ensures your engine receives a consistent flow of fuel, even under extreme conditions like hard cornering, rapid acceleration, or prolonged high-RPM driving. If your pump can’t keep up, you risk fuel starvation, which can lead to engine misfires, power loss, or even catastrophic damage. So, what should you look for in a fuel pump for track-focused builds?
First, prioritize **flow rate and pressure**. Track cars often run modified engines with upgraded turbochargers, injectors, or nitrous systems, all of which demand more fuel than a stock setup. A pump that delivers 255 liters per hour (LPH) or higher is a common starting point for mild builds, but serious applications may require 340 LPH or more. Pressure is equally important—look for pumps that maintain stable pressure (typically 45-85 psi) across varying temperatures and load conditions.
Next, **durability and heat resistance** are non-negotiable. Track environments generate intense heat, especially near the fuel tank. Cheap pumps with plastic components or weak motors can fail prematurely. Opt for pumps with billet aluminum housings, robust internals, and designs tested for thermal stability. Some aftermarket pumps even include integrated cooling features to mitigate heat soak during extended sessions.
Compatibility is another key factor. Does the pump fit your specific fuel tank design? Can it handle ethanol-blended fuels like E85, which are popular in racing due to their cooling properties and octane ratings? Always double-check the manufacturer’s specifications to avoid installation headaches or performance gaps.

Installation tips matter too. Always mount the pump as close to the fuel tank as possible to minimize strain on the motor. Use high-quality wiring and relays to handle the electrical load, and consider adding a surge tank if your car suffers from fuel slosh during hard braking or cornering. Regular maintenance—like replacing filters and inspecting connections—can extend the pump’s lifespan.
Lastly, don’t overlook noise. Some high-flow pumps can be loud, which might annoy you during street driving (if your track car is dual-purpose). Look for models with noise-dampening features or rubber mounting options to keep things quiet when you’re off the circuit.
